Quick answer: Aquamar has launched “Break Free from Chickensanity,” a surreal integrated campaign from ONE23WEST that positions repetitive chicken dinners as the real enemy and Aquamar’s easy-to-prepare seafood as the way out.

When the Real Competitor Is Routine

Aquamar is taking aim at one of North America’s most repetitive dinner habits: chicken.

Created with ONE23WEST, the campaign “Break Free from Chickensanity” reframes dinner monotony as the problem the brand wants to solve.

Instead of competing only against other seafood brands, Aquamar identifies routine itself as the enemy.

Turning Dinner Repetition Into a Thriller

The campaign dramatizes that idea through a surreal film showing a family trapped in an endless loop of chicken dinners.

The repetition gradually becomes unsettling, turning an ordinary meal habit into something closer to a psychological thriller.

Aquamar’s fuss-free seafood breaks the cycle and becomes the escape.

Why Chickensanity Works

The idea is intentionally strange.

That is part of the strategy.

Rather than simply saying seafood is easy to prepare, Aquamar exaggerates the boredom of repetitive meals until the audience is forced to reconsider the habit.

The product benefit then becomes simple: variety without extra effort.

Unfishingbelievable Rebuilds the Brand

The campaign is supported by Aquamar’s new brand platform, “Unfishingbelievable.”

The refresh moves away from familiar seafood category conventions such as blue packaging, fisherman imagery and overly serious product language.

Instead, Aquamar adopts a louder, more playful tone designed to stand out both in advertising and on shelf.

A Brand Refresh Built for Expansion

The new identity includes bold, vibrant packaging intended to give Aquamar stronger shelf presence as the company expands beyond its surimi roots into a broader convenience seafood portfolio.

That makes the refresh more than a cosmetic redesign.

It gives the company a more flexible identity for future growth across North America.

What Brands Can Learn

  • Your real competitor may be a behavior, not another brand.
  • Routine can become a powerful source of creative tension.
  • Humor can help reposition traditional categories.
  • Brand refreshes work best when tone, packaging and campaign idea reinforce each other.
  • Strange ideas can earn attention when they remain connected to a clear product benefit.

Final Reflection: Attack the Habit, Not Just the Competition

Aquamar’s strongest move is defining chicken repetition as the enemy.

That gives the brand a much bigger story than simply asking consumers to try another seafood product.

By turning dinner boredom into “Chickensanity,” Aquamar creates a memorable reason to break the routine.
